The Global X Euro STOXX 50 Covered Call UCITS ETF (ticker: IT:SYLD) is a sophisticated financial instrument designed for investors seeking to capitalize on the dynamic European equity market while generating additional income through an options strategy. This ETF is meticulously crafted to track the EURO STOXX 50 Covered Call ATM Index, offering exposure to 50 of the largest and most liquid stocks in the Eurozone.
Positioned within the Total Market category, IT:SYLD focuses on a Broad-based niche by implementing a covered call strategy. This involves writing call options on the underlying stocks to enhance yield, making it a compelling choice for investors looking for a blend of capital appreciation potential and income generation. Such a strategy can potentially reduce volatility and provide a buffer against market downturns, as the premium collected from selling call options serves as an additional income stream.
